fix win32 dos prompt io
parent
d5271aa5b8
commit
416edff582
|
@ -31,9 +31,11 @@ M: c-stream stream-close
|
||||||
>r f <c-stream> <line-reader> f r> <c-stream> <plain-writer>
|
>r f <c-stream> <line-reader> f r> <c-stream> <plain-writer>
|
||||||
<duplex-stream> ;
|
<duplex-stream> ;
|
||||||
|
|
||||||
: init-io ( -- )
|
: init-c-io ( -- )
|
||||||
13 getenv 14 getenv <duplex-c-stream> stdio set ;
|
13 getenv 14 getenv <duplex-c-stream> stdio set ;
|
||||||
|
|
||||||
|
: init-io init-c-io ;
|
||||||
|
|
||||||
: io-multiplex ( ms -- ) drop ;
|
: io-multiplex ( ms -- ) drop ;
|
||||||
|
|
||||||
IN: io
|
IN: io
|
||||||
|
|
|
@ -37,5 +37,6 @@ IN: io-internals
|
||||||
|
|
||||||
: init-io ( -- )
|
: init-io ( -- )
|
||||||
win32-init-stdio
|
win32-init-stdio
|
||||||
init-winsock ;
|
init-winsock
|
||||||
|
init-c-io ;
|
||||||
|
|
||||||
|
|
Loading…
Reference in New Issue